Output 586a64174b6cad31394c1482e1df700a8c25fbae8f92dc85f3aa22bb39f08c88:1

value
136864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ce2aef28e8f37b13008c4d621890b7ab0e820840 OP_EQUAL
address
3LV8ZBYTudMMFwWj7qgaWeGkZ1enmqia56
transaction
586a64174b6cad31394c1482e1df700a8c25fbae8f92dc85f3aa22bb39f08c88
spent
true